What is PCBA Manufacturing?

PCBA manufacturing involves several steps that ensure a printed circuit board (PCB) is ready for installation in electronic devices. It encompasses processes such as soldering components onto the PCB, testing the board, and ensuring quality control before the final product is released. The success of PCBA manufacturing relies heavily on both precision and efficiency.

Key Applications of PCBA Manufacturing

PCBA manufacturing is utilized across various industries, owing to its versatility and efficiency. Here are some key applications:

  • Consumer Electronics: Smartphones, tablets, and laptops heavily depend on PCBA for their functionalities.
  • Automotive Industry: Modern vehicles are now equipped with numerous electronic systems that integrate PCBA in functions such as navigation, infotainment systems, and safety features.
  • Medical Devices: Critical equipment like diagnostic machines and patient monitoring systems showcase the importance of reliable PCBA manufacturing.
  • Industrial Equipment: Automation systems and control devices in manufacturing settings utilize advanced PCBAs to enhance performance and productivity.
  • Telecommunications: PCBA is essential in the creation of devices that enable communication, such as routers and switches.

Benefits of PCBA Manufacturing

The advantages of PCBA manufacturing extend beyond basic functionality. Here are some primary benefits:

  1. Cost-Effective Production: Automation in PCBA manufacturing reduces labor costs and minimizes errors. This leads to lower overall production costs.

  2. High Precision: Advances in technology have allowed for greater precision in component placement and soldering. This precision ensures reliability in final products.

  3. Scalability: PCBA manufacturing can easily scale to accommodate small or large production volumes, making it suitable for various business sizes.

  4. Improved Performance: PCBAs are designed to enhance the performance of electronic devices. Their compact nature also contributes to the miniaturization of products.

Common Problems in PCBA Manufacturing and Solutions

Despite its advantages, PCBA manufacturing can face challenges. Here are a few common issues and practical solutions to address them:

  • Soldering Issues: Inconsistent solder joints can lead to poor connections.

    • Solution: Implement automated solder inspection systems to detect defects early in the process.
  • Component Misalignment: Misplaced components can jeopardize functionality.

    • Solution: Utilize vision systems for precise component placement during assembly.
  • Quality Control Failures: Inadequate testing can lead to defective products reaching customers.

    • Solution: Establish a rigorous quality assurance process that includes functional testing and inspection at every production stage.
  • Material Shortages: Supply chain disruptions can lead to delays.

    • Solution: Maintain good relationships with multiple suppliers to ensure a steady supply of materials.

Best Practices for Successful PCBA Manufacturing

Following best practices can enhance the efficiency and quality of PCBA manufacturing. Consider these suggestions:

  • Design for Manufacturability (DFM): Engage with manufacturers early during the design phase to ensure that the product is optimized for assembly.

  • Regular Training: Keep the production team informed and trained on the latest PCBA techniques and technologies.

  • Invest in Quality Equipment: Upgrading to modern machinery can improve production rates and reduce the likelihood of defects.
